Understanding Return to Player (RTP)
The concept of Return to Player (RTP) is vital when assessing the long-term viability of any Plinko game. RTP represents the percentage of total wagered funds that are returned to players over a significant period. A higher RTP indicates a more favorable game for players. While the RTP is usually not explicitly stated on the game itself, understanding this concept helps in managing expectations. Even with a seemingly advantageous strategy, if the game has a low RTP, the odds are stacked against the player in the long run. Finding games with a demonstrably higher RTP is always a good starting point for any serious Plinko player. Factors such as the number of pegs, the prize distribution, and the overall game design all contribute to the RTP.
